Etiquette

At Russian Church of Saint Nicholas, a visitor enters on the community's terms. For Russian Church of Saint Nicholas, wear modest clothing, make space for prayer, and treat photography as permission-based rather than automatic. In this account of Russian Church of Saint Nicholas, do not handle devotional objects or imitate rituals without invitation from a recognised custodian.
